We are pleased to collaborate with The Trustees for the 2026 Scenic Songs Series, bringing Passim’s renowned folk music into these incredible outdoor settings. The Trustees is Massachusetts’ largest—and the nation’s first—land conservation and preservation nonprofit. Today, through the support of Members, donors, and partners, The Trustees helps conserve nearly 52,000 acres and welcomes the public to more than 120 inspiring locations across the state to experience landscapes where nature, wildlife, and people all thrive.

Nora Meier is a diehard music fan, a frequent moviegoer, a daughter of two English majors, an Oregonian at heart, a verbal processor, a big reader, extremely stubborn, and always writing. She was raised on her dad’s curated mixtapes and epic vinyl collection, which cultivated her deep love for the format of The Album and an obsession with Bruce Springsteen.

Her very own debut album, Outfield, was released in October of 2024. It was born during a full moon /  lunar eclipse on a farm in Connecticut with the help of some of her favorite musicians. Eleven songs were tracked in seven days, interspersed by basketball scrimmages, deli trips and walks around a big field. The album was produced and mixed by Charles Dahlke (The Brazen Youth) and mastered by Andrew Goldring.

Nora lives in Boston, Massachusetts.

Alouette Batteau

Alouette Batteau is a vocalist and songwriter, best known as one-third of Kalliope Jones (with Isabella DeHerdt and Wes Chalfant), a post-rock power trio from Western Massachusetts. Originally a folk-rock group, Kalliope Jones has developed its soundscape to bend gender-genre-genius from r&b, pop punk, and alt indie. The band has performed at the Falcon Ridge Folk Festival, the Iron Horse Music Hall, the Wolftrap Center for Performing Arts, Club Passim, and Dar Williams’ River Roads Festival, sharing stages with Amy Ray, Shawn Colvin, and Lisa Loeb.

Nicolás Emden is a talented multi-instrumentalist, composer, singer, and songwriter, hailing from Chilean Patagonia. His music navigates the waters of pop, rock, and South American folk, creating a distinctive South Americana indie folk rock sound, with evocative Spanish lyrics.

Emden began his musical journey at the age of six, through South American folk and church music, singing and playing acoustic nylon guitar. His early musical career saw him founding the Chilean band Tejado Pimiento (2007-2012), with which he won the national TV contest “Garage Music” and released two albums as the main songwriter of the group, “Triciclo” (2007) and “Sensación de verdad” (2010). In 2014, he launched his solo career with the album “Como Los Pájaros,” accompanied by a YouTube documentary series, “Como Los Pájaros x Chile,” showcasing his new music busking through the streets of multiple Chilean cities.

Since moving to Boston in 2014 to study at Berklee College of Music, Emden has continued to expand his musical horizons, performing and touring throughout the United States, Canada, and Chile. His involvement in diverse artistic projects, ranging from folk and rock to contemporary music theater, reflects his commitment to using music as a universal language to connect people together, globally​.

In 2023, Nicolás released two singles, “Sin Ti” and “Todo Volverá,” and won the World Act of the Year at the New England Music Awards (NEMAs). Additionally, he was selected as one of the 2023 Iguana Fund recipients of Club Passim in Cambridge, MA, for recording his second studio album.
